How much does it cost to rent a home in Atlanta?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Atlanta 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,292 | $999 | $9,000 |
Atlanta 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,728 | $1,050 | $10,000+ |
Atlanta 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,020 | $1,400 | $10,000+ |
Atlanta 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,905 | $850 | $10,000+ |
Atlanta 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$11,946 | $2,999 | $10,000+ |
Atlanta 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$8,781 | $2,100 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Atlanta
What type of rentals are currently available in Atlanta?
There are currently 3499 Apartments for Rent in Atlanta, GA with pricing that ranges from $200 to $26,170. There are also 3488 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Atlanta ranging from $497 to $48,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Atlanta?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Atlanta ranges from $497 to $48,000 with an average monthly rent of $6,229.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Atlanta?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Atlanta range from $820 to $17,062,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,050 to $20,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,400 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$755.
